In the fast-evolving realm of artificial intelligence, the importance of robust, real-world data cannot be overstated. Google, a pioneer in AI research and development, has taken a significant step towards democratizing access to such data through its Data Commons initiative. Recently, Google announced the integration of an MCP Server into Data Commons, a move that is poised to revolutionize how AI systems interact with and learn from vast quantities of real-world information.
The incorporation of the MCP Server into Google’s Data Commons marks a watershed moment in the field of AI. This development effectively streamlines the process by which AI algorithms can tap into a wealth of diverse, real-world data sources. By providing AI systems with easier access to such information, Google is essentially empowering these systems to enhance their learning capabilities and make more informed decisions.
For AI training pipelines, this enhancement is nothing short of a game-changer. Training AI models typically requires large amounts of high-quality data to ensure effective learning outcomes. With the MCP Server now in place, AI developers and researchers can expedite the training process by leveraging Google’s Data Commons to access a broader range of real-world data sets. This not only accelerates the pace of AI development but also enriches the quality of insights derived from these models.
